Foundation underpinning services involve reinforcing or stabilizing the existing foundation of a property to address structural issues caused by settling, shifting, or deterioration. This process typically includes installing additional support elements beneath the foundation, such as piers, piles, or underpinning systems, to restore stability and prevent further movement. The goal is to ensure that the building remains safe and level, reducing the risk of costly damages or safety hazards. Foundation underpinning is a practical solution for homeowners experiencing signs of foundation problems, helping to preserve the integrity of the property over time.
Problems that underpinning services help solve often stem from foundation settlement, uneven sinking, or shifting soil conditions. Common warning signs include cracked walls, uneven floors, sticking doors or windows, and visible cracks in the foundation or exterior walls. These issues can worsen if left unaddressed, leading to more extensive structural damage and expensive repairs. Underpinning provides a way to correct these issues by strengthening the foundation from beneath, offering a long-term solution that stabilizes the entire structure and helps prevent future problems.
Properties that typically benefit from underpinning services include older homes with original foundations, buildings experiencing ongoing settlement, or structures built on expansive or unstable soil. Residential properties with noticeable foundation cracks or uneven floors are often candidates for underpinning work. Additionally, properties that have experienced nearby construction, soil movement, or water drainage issues may require foundation reinforcement. The overview below groups typical Foundation Underpinning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Elgin, IL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or underpinning work in Elgin, IL range from $250 to $600. Many routine repairs fall within this band, especially for localized foundation stabilization or small pier installations. Larger, more complex projects can exceed this range but are less common.
Moderate Projects - For more extensive underpinning, such as underpinning a section of a foundation or addressing moderate settling, costs generally fall between $1,000 and $3,000. These are common for homes experiencing noticeable but manageable shifts.
Major Underpinning - Larger projects involving significant foundation stabilization or multiple areas can range from $3,500 to $8,000. While many projects stay within this range, complex or highly challenging conditions may push costs higher.
Full Foundation Replacement - Complete foundation replacement or extensive underpinning for large structures can reach $15,000 or more. These are less frequent but necessary for severe structural issues or historic properties requiring detailed work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is foundation underpinning? Foundation underpinning involves strengthening or stabilizing a building's foundation to address issues like settling or shifting, ensuring structural integrity.
How do I know if my foundation needs underpinning? Signs such as visible cracks, uneven floors, or doors and windows that don’t close properly may indicate a need for foundation underpinning.
What methods are used for foundation underpinning? Local contractors may use techniques like pier installation, mudjacking, or slab jacking to reinforce and stabilize foundations.
Is foundation underpinning suitable for all types of foundations? Underpinning can be adapted for various foundation types, but a professional assessment is recommended to determine the best approach.
